Default 2000 ezgo 36v golf cart

I have a 2000 ezgo that had a bad motor terminal are A1 A2-S1 S2 and I bout a use motor is a 2005 and it has a speed sensor and the motor has terminal A1 A2, F1-F2 tryies to go but won’t move at all only runs when is up in jack stand, so per sensor wires are cut off the motor , what can I do to fix it

Default Re: 2000 ezgo 36v golf cart

You bought a Sepex motor for a series cart. That won’t work. They are totally different drive systems.
